There are several scenarios in which these proposed changes will in my opinion add annoyance to the game:
1.) You are running missions with a group of people. I understand that nerving mission isk output vs time is not neccessarly something you guys are unhappy with, but have you considered that this just adds time for people to sit around and do nothing while waiting for the warps to finish? It would seem to me that in an allready rather slow game as EVE it would be not a good design decision to add time for people to float around and do nothing.
2.) It makes preparation in advance less meaningful. So if I have a group of dedicated people outside primetime that will go around to a hostile system and prepare tactical BMs, currently this is a big advantage. The FC can then have the bookmarks and use them in the fight. In the new proposed system I need to have someone in a cloaked ship or interceptor to provide fleet warpins on these locations. In any case it will make the fleet slower, which is again the intended outcome I understand, but it also makes the individuals less meaningfull preparing the BMs in the first place, is this also as intended?
3.) It either puts more stress on the FC or it creates an utterly boring fleet role. So either the FC needs to have yet another cloaky alt or interceptor alt to provide warpins on bookmarks and scan results, or this role needs to be filled by another fleet member. Have you considered that sitting in an interceptor (or cov-ops) for a whole fleet fight just to give warpins on bookmarks, but being unable to shoot anything, is an utterly dull and boring role to play? I get that in a realistic (whatever that means for internet spaceships :D) scenario it would be a desireable and important role to fill .... but in the reality of the game a large percentage of people would like to shoot stuff...
4.) Warping to locations in tidi. Have you considered that in big fleet fights with tidi active the effect of this change will be massively amplyfied? So in these allready extremly slow scenarios you would potentially double the time to warp to a scan result or a bookmark. So instead of people sitting idle for 5 minutes it might be 10 minutes afterwards. Do you think it is good gameplay to sit idle for 10 minutes while waiting for a warp to finish (number is pulled from thin air, please replace with more realistic number if you have it) ?
Anyway, I guess my point is, not every decision that might make sense in terms of balancing things is neccessarly a decision that will increase FUN for people playing the GAME.
